PM Shehbaz returns to Islamabad after concluding Qatar visit

ISLAMABAD(National Times)-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if returned to Islamabad on Wednesday after concluding his Qatar tour. During the visit, the prime minister held a meeting with the Amir of Qatar, Tamim bin Hamad Al Thani. The Qatari leader reaffirmed his commitment to elevating bilateral economic partnership to a higher strategic level and agreed to maintain close coordination on key regional issues.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Ishaq Dar and Chief of Army Staff Field Marshal Asim Munir were also present during the meeting.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if also met with the Prime Minister of Qatar, senior Qatari officials including the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of State for Foreign Trade, as well as a delegation from the Qatar Businessmen Association to discuss avenues for enhancing trade and investment cooperation between the two countries.
